Investment Info:

Single-family residence buy & hold investment in Bridgeport.

Purchase price: $180,000
Cash invested: $20,000

Short term rental, 2bed/2bath

What made you interested in investing in this type of deal?

A mix of personal use (translated, we wanted it to be nice enough for us to want to spend time there) and an interest in creating positive cash flow as a side Hussle

How did you find this deal and how did you negotiate it?

Realtor assisted.

How did you add value to the deal?

Improved the outdoor space to add "experience" value to the property

What was the outcome?

Well received. Books at a good price and is fairly busy for an Albuquerque property.

Lessons learned? Challenges?

You really have to be "all in" to do well with an STR
